When ZTE repairs a defective product, they may use rebuilt, reconditioned, or new parts and components. Alternatively, they may replace the defective product entirely with a rebuilt, reconditioned, or new ZTE product.

The IMEI (International Mobile Equipment Identity) is a unique identifier for your phone. ZTE will need this to check your warranty status in their system.
